Publisher Description

It all starts with a phone call in the middle of the night. Part time private investigator/full-time rancher Dutch Evans groggily takes a call from a woman named Sharlene who has a big problem: murder. His empty bank account, and the fact that Sharlene is the daughter of an old flame, is enough to arouse his interest, to the tune of traveling cross country and to the other side of the world in order to find complex answers to what should be a routine investigation. Before he knows it, malice and murder become the status quo for this cowboy P.I.

The Odor of Death is a thrill-a-minute ride that lovers of mystery and adventure will not want to miss.
